Deciphering MHC I Multimer Technology: A Revolution from Molecular Design to Immune Monitoring
Cytotoxic T lymphocytes (CTLs), serving as core effector cells in immune responses, execute critical immune surveillance functions through the specific recognition of antigens via their T cell receptors (TCRs). During antigen recognition, the CD8 co-receptor of CTLs collaborates with TCRs to precisely identify antigenic peptides presented by MHC class I molecules.
